1 FRUIT - Adult portion size = 80g Fruit Adult portion size examples - approximately equivalent to 80g in weight (As eaten, edible portion, drained if canned) Apple: fresh 1 medium apple Apple: unsweetened 100% apple puree 2 heaped tablespoons Apricot: canned 6 halves Apricot: fresh 3 apricots Avocado Half an avocado Banana: fresh 1 medium banana Blackberries 1 handful (9 to 10 blackberries) Blackcurrants Blueberries 2 handfuls () Cherries: canned 11 cherries () Cherries: fresh 14 cherries Clementines 2 clementines Damsons 5 to 6 damsons Fig: fresh 2 figs Fruit juice: 100%, unsweetened 1 small glass (150ml) of unsweetened 100% fruit and/or vegetable juice can count as a maximum of one portion. It is recommended that we limit 100% fruit/vegetable juices and smoothies to a combined total of 150ml per day (one portion) and consume with meals to reduce the risk of tooth decay. 2 Fruit smoothie: 100%, unsweetened 1 small glass (150ml) of unsweetened 100% fruit and/or vegetable smoothie can count as a maximum of one portion. A portion of unsweetened 100% fruit and/or vegetable smoothie includes 150ml of fruit/vegetable juice; puree; edible pulp or a combination of these. It is recommended that we limit 100% fruit juices and smoothies to a combined total of 150ml per day (one portion) and consume with meals to reduce the risk of tooth decay.
